  • My Name is Earl

    Earl Hickey is an unrepentant ne'er-do-well with a long list of things he's done wrong in life. All that changes when he wins a small lottery and, in a swift twist of fate, learns the meaning of 'karma': Do good things and good things happen. Now Earl, along with a quirky group of family, friends and a particularly troublesome ex-wife, is on a mission to right all his past wrongs and, one-by-one, cross them off his list. It makes for a comedy, like Earl himself, with a voice and style all its own.

  • MadTV

    MADtv is a late night sketch comedy television show. MADtv premiered in 1995 and, over the years, has become famous for its sharp parodies of film, television and music. During its 12 year history MADtv has produced well over 2000 sketches and 280 plus episodes. MADtv has featured hundreds of guest stars and musical acts including: Susan Sarandon, Kathy Bates, Jack Black, Dennis Hopper, Halle Berry, George Carlin, Seth Green, Martin Short, Jackie Chan, Snoop Dogg, Gwen Stefani, LL Cool J, Queen Latifah, Drew Barrymore, Jon Heder, Ludacris, Nicole Richie, Alanis Morrisette, Avril Lavigne, Nelly, Ryan Reynolds, Don Cheadle, Howie Mandel, Pam Anderson and Green Day -- to name only a few. During its 12 seasons, MADtv has created a variety of original characters including: Ms. Swan, Stuart, Bae Sung, Coach Hines, Jovan Muskatelle, Eugene "HNL" Struthers, Blind Kung Fu Master and Tank among several others.

  • Bewitched

    In every way, Samantha and Darrin Stephens are a perfectly normal, all-American couple, except for one small detail...Samantha's a witch! And although she promised her husband on their wedding night never to use her powers, Samantha can't seem to resist performing a quick trick or two to get out of a jam. Further complicating matters is Samantha's mother, Endora, who is appalled that her daughter married a mere "mortal" and does her spell-assisted best to break them apart!
